Four zebras grazing on the winter grass in Botswana, lined up nicely in the same direction. Their unique stripes create a beautiful abstract only nature can create.
There is no animal that has a distinct coat like the zebra. Unlike their close relatives, horses and donkeys, zebra have never been truly domesticated although some individuals have successfully tamed them.
Botswana's national animal is the graceful zebra with its breathtaking distinctive black and white stripes.
The Okavango Delta is one of the best places in Botswana to see Zebra.
